In general, a person becomes contagious from a few days before their symptoms begin until all of their symptoms have gone. This means most people will be infectious for around two weeks.

WebWhen you have a cold sore outbreak: The first sign of a cold sore is usually a tingling, burning, or itching sensation on or around the lips, beginning about 12-24 hours before the cold sore develops. The area becomes red, swollen and painful as the blisters form. Over 2-3 days, the blisters rupture and ooze fluid that is clear or slightly ... The most common cold symptoms typically include: a tickle, soreness, or scratchiness in the back of your throat. a runny nose. nasal congestion. sneezing. a cough. mild body aches and pains. headache. not feeling well (malaise) fever, although this is less common in adults.
